学习中遇到I2C通信(半双工)和SPI通信协议(全双工),下面简单介绍下几种通信传送方式:
数据通信中,数据在线路上的传送方式可以分为单工通信、半双工通信和全双工通信三种。
单工通信:指消息只能单方向传输的工作方式。例如遥控、遥测就是单工通信方式。
单工通信信道是单向信道,发送端和接收端的身份是固定的,发送端只能发送消息,不能接收消息;接收端只能接收消息,不能发送消息,数据信号仅从一端传送到另一端,即信息流是单方向的。
通信双方采用“按--讲”(Push To Talk,PTT)单工通信属于点对点的通信,根据收发频率的异同,单工通信可分为同频通信和异频通信。
半双工通信:是指数据可以沿两个方向传送,但同一时刻一个信道只允许